I liked how everything was put together in this one. Also, I'm curious how you cut out the silhouette of the dancer like that. Did you use Photoshop's magic wand, or is there an easier way in flash, or did you have to lasso it? I'd appreciate it if you let me know, thanks! Anyway, the music was fun too. I also like how efficient the whole thing was with memory size. It wasn't some huge thing you have to wait around for like other videos. I think a lot of videos could be a lot more efficient with their size. So overall, good job! :)

razorbjc responds:

the bellydancing part was done with rotoscoping. You just import a video of something (embed it in flash) and then trace the image frame by frame on a layer over it with the paintbrush. that belly dancer took about 300 individual frames.
